In other dubious news, my ever-entertaining political mailing lists are now encouraging me to vote absentee. The rationale is that by voting absentee:
1) You'll have a paper trail (unlike with touchscreen machines).
2) You'll be able to do other things on Election Day like give people rides to the polls and answer any personal work/home emergencies that come up.
3) It'll give your candidate warm fuzzies to have votes already before November 2 even comes.
4) Polling places are going to be overwhelmed on Election Day.

I have no good argument against #1 except that if the election is going to be stolen, it will be -- they'll find a way. As for #2, I'm not going to be able to take the day off to help, but I'll make time to actually vote. #3 is not compelling. #4? True, but election officials are also overwhelmed by absentee ballots from actual absentee voters. Let's get those processed before able-bodied locals start voting absentee just to get a receipt.
